How to Set Up a GoPro as a Security Camera

If you want to use your GoPro as a security camera, follow these steps to set it up:

  1. Choose a suitable location for your GoPro camera where it can capture the area you want to monitor.
  2. Make sure your GoPro is fully charged or connected to a power source for continuous monitoring.
  3. Install a microSD card in your GoPro to store the recorded footage.
  4. Download the official GoPro app on your smartphone or tablet to remotely monitor the camera.
  5. Set up the Wi-Fi connection on your GoPro and pair it with your mobile device.
  6. Access the live feed from your GoPro camera on the app and adjust the settings as needed.
  7. Enable motion detection or continuous recording mode for security monitoring.
  8. Ensure that your GoPro camera has a clear view of the monitored area and is securely mounted.
  9. Regularly check the footage on the app to monitor any suspicious activity or events.

Configuring the Camera for Security Monitoring

Setting up your GoPro as a security camera involves configuring the camera settings to ensure it captures the footage you need for monitoring your space. Here are the steps to configure your GoPro for security monitoring:

  1. Connect your GoPro to a power source to ensure continuous operation.
  2. Access the camera settings menu on your GoPro device.
  3. Adjust the video resolution and frame rate to suit your monitoring needs. Higher resolution and frame rates may provide clearer footage but may also require more storage space.
  4. Enable looping recording to ensure that the camera continues to record footage even when the storage is full. This feature overwrites the oldest footage with the newest recordings.
  5. Set up motion detection if your GoPro model supports this feature. Motion detection can trigger the camera to start recording when movement is detected in the frame.
  6. Configure the camera’s Wi-Fi settings if you plan to monitor the footage remotely. This will allow you to access the live feed or recorded footage from a distance.
